    In a quaint Missouri town, Devereaux "Dev" Sinclair faces unexpected challenges as she runs her five-and-dime shop and hosts local book clubs. When a poet is murdered after a heated reading group meeting, Dev feels the pressure to clear her name and save her business. With the help of two handsome suitors, she delves into the investigation, navigating threats and uncovering secrets. The story blends mystery with romance, as Dev races against time to solve the case before she becomes the next victim.

    A cupcake contest at Devereaux "Dev" Sinclair's five-and-dime store takes a dark turn when a contestant is found dead. As Dev navigates the sweet chaos of the competition, she must unravel the mystery surrounding the murder, uncovering secrets and rivalries among the contestants. With a blend of charm and suspense, the story explores themes of community, competition, and the lengths people will go to for victory. Dev's determination to solve the crime adds a thrilling twist to her quaint small-town life.

    In Shadow Bend, Missouri, Devereaux "Dev" Sinclair's new dime store becomes the backdrop for a gripping mystery when she partners with handsome private investigator Jake Del Vecchio. Their first case centers on the disappearance of Gabriella Winston, the wife of a wealthy philanthropist facing community backlash over his wildlife park plans. As suspicions arise around Elliot Winston, Dev is determined to uncover the truth, revealing that rural life can be just as perilous as city living.
